> Inability to pre-emptive schedule. If the scheduler happens to have an
> incremental and a full backup scheduled for the same day, I would like to have
> the incremental automatically pre-empted as unnecessary since the full would
> cover everything that the incremental would've anyways.
>
This is supposed to work the way you wish. In fact, the behavior that has been
told to me by consulting, support, and other users that it is possible to have
a full, incremental, and diff running at the same time, or on the same day, is
a bug. While at Vision, I spoke to Mark Winger, who is principle developer of
the scheduler. He had never heard of this behavior before and is very
interested in any documented cases being opened as a support call so this bug
can be worked out.
